The most famous chinese silver dollar from the late Qing era is most likely the Y31 silver dollar, colloquially referred to as “宣三” in China. It was minted in 1911 (3rd year of the rule of Xuan Tong) at the Central Mint in Tianjin. Oct 4, 2023 · These holed coins, also known as Chinese cash coins, are very cheap. In fact, 99% of these coins are priced at less than USD 10. Chinese spade moneys and Chinese knife coins are other forms of ancient Chinese coinages that resemble spade and sword, respectively. These coins are worth around USD 30. China has a very long tradition of using coins. The same design of coinage lasted 2,000 years and it was the first country to introduce paper money. The fen (分 /fnn/), 1/100th of a yuan, is so seldom used now that fen coins and notes are almost out of circulation. Paper notes come in 1 and 5 jiao, 1, 2, 5, 10, 20, 50 and 100 yuan denominations, though the 2 Yuan Note is rarely seen these days. There are also 1 jiao, 5 jiao and 1 yuan coins. Round coins occur in three general types. 1) All with a round hole. 2) Square hole types with two characters. 3) Square hole types with four character types. Just click on the type that best fits your coin. Quick identification of unknown Chinese cast coins.
